This poem is about every day struggles and the decisions we all make.
The struggle of not turning to the right or the left

That sound good, maybe even fun but will it lead us to stray

Away from truth and into darkness

From the light that does now guide us

You seem so niceā€¦ Attractive too

But you drink from the cup one should not choose

Could you change into the light for which we strive

To share it with you, may bring the change

Is it purpose or just a lonely heart?

That should not be followed off this straight and narrow path

Not turning to the right or to the left

But just a little fun one night with friends

Out on the town a band of mighty thieves

Out to plight and to destroy that once honored and sacred joy

That extinguished the light that no one sees

And darkness floods from all around

But within there still remains a little flicker

Of the light from the path that stands so straight

And guides us back from the loose stones of the right and the left

To the solid ground on which one should stand

Out of the darkness, once again in the light
